In 1997, after military service in the Armed Forces of the Russian Federation he immigrated to Israel, where he worked in the “Clalit†hospital in Tel Aviv and got interested in the organization of medical care at Israeli standards. In 2006 he returned to Russia to bring the experience in Moscow. "On the one hand, I knew at that time there were no competitors in Moscow despite the huge amount of dental clinics. With the exception of maybe a few of them, where they had a higher price range with the same finest standard of treatment. On the other hand, I knew how hard we should work on teaching people to take care of their teeth properly. So, I just say: “Smile more often, especially do so at yourselves in the mirror.
